Hello everyone, 
> 
> I have a question concerning the validity of the
solar data in the FI-Helsinki-Airport-29740.tm2 weather file. 
> 
>
After running my simulation with a typical year of Helsinki weather, I
got the following errors concerning solar data: 
> 
> _"The calculated
total horizontal radiation exceeded the horizontal extraterrestrial
radiation and was set to the extraterrestrial for 1212 timesteps during
the simulation"_ 
> 
> _"The calculated horizontal beam radiation
exceeded the provided total horizontal radiation and was set to the
total horizontal radiation for 4 timesteps during the simulation"_ 
> 
>
To get the typical solar data for Helsinki, I modified the global
horizontal, direct normal and diffuse horizontal solar data in the tm2
file (according to: _Development of weighting factors for climate
variables for selecting the energy reference year according to the EN
ISO 15927-4 standard. _Kalamees, T., Jylhä, K., Tietäväinen, H.,
Jokisalo, J., Ilomets, S., Hyvönen, R. and Saku, S. Vols. Energy and
Buildings 47 (2012) 53-60.), leaving the extraterrestrial data
untouched. 
> 
> I found out that one reason behind the errors was that
the extraterrestrial solar data do not seem to be valid. For example, in
the tm2 file, there are only 5 hours of extraterrestrial solar data for
the shortest days of the year. In reality however, the minimum daylight
hours is just under 6 hours… 
> 
> So my question is, does anyone know
of a valid method to circumvent this inconsistent extraterrestrial data
problem? Can I simply set all of the extraterrestrial radiation values
to a high number throughout the year (and how useful are these if
non-extraterrestrial radiation data are already provided)?
